We offer test-optional admission to our graduate programs.

Candidates for admission may choose to submit a GMAT or GRE score if they do not think their work experience or academic performance accurately reflects their potential for success in graduate study.

Although the GMAT or GRE is not required for admission, applicants submitting strong test scores (500+ GMAT, 305+ GRE) will automatically be considered for fellowships and certain endowed scholarships. Candidates with less than a 3.25/4.0 CGPA will be required to submit a GMAT or GRE score in order to be considered for Graduate Assistantships.

Accelerated Degree Pathways

The Graduate School of Business offers two accelerated pathways to earn an MBA, allowing qualified students to complete graduate coursework as part of their undergraduate program of study.

Dual Screen computer

BSBA-to-MBA

Duquesne undergraduate business majors are permitted to enroll in Duquesne's BSBA-to-MBA program. This program permits qualified students to earn up to six credits of fundamental course waivers and take up to six credits of core Professional MBA (PMBA) classes to fulfill undergraduate elective requirements. Since undergraduate tuition is a flat rate for students enrolling in up to 18 credit hours, the BSBA-to-MBA path essentially reduces the cost of the PMBA program by up to 12 credit hours.

Hands on a laptop

Fast-Track PMBA

Qualified Duquesne undergraduates in non-business majors are permitted to register for up to six credits of fundamental MBA courses. Since undergraduate tuition is a flat rate for students enrolling in up to 18 credit hours, this fast-track path reduces the cost of the PMBA program by up to 6 credit hours. This program provides a valuable opportunity to explore whether an MBA is a good fit - without compromising students' ability to complete their major or a business certificate.

Center for Student Success

The Eugene P. Beard Center for Student Success (CSS) launched in fall 2022, marking the beginning of a new era for the Palumbo-Donahue School of Business. The Center is the realization of the School's integrated, holistic approach for serving students. To realize this vision, staff roles across the school were reimagined to better support students, and the 7th floor of Rockwell Hall was completely renovated, making the Center a physical reality.
